Hiding your SSID is not going to do squat against even a child hacker. Your primary defense should be your authentication @ WPA2-PSK or WPA-PSK. I don't know if you've ever played with WIFI Monster but it will locate and display hidden networks ALL DAY LONG. Don't waste your time use better encryption.
